Ticket BRK-92: Circuit breaker misconfig in Velstra upstream client

Reviewer note: staging env set the breaker's failure threshold to 0, so it trips instantly and never recovers. Fix sets `VELSTRA_BREAKER_THRESHOLD=5` and `VELSTRA_BREAKER_COOLDOWN=30s`. The upstream client also needs its API credential restored directly below those two lines. It belongs immediately after this sentence.

sealed setting: ARCHIVE_KEY3=8d0

The nightly pipeline for Querylint, our SQL linting rule pack, began rejecting the rules bundle at the verification stage this morning. The bundle itself is unchanged since last week; diffing confirms identical content hashes. Our working theory is that the verifier on the Bramleigh runner is still pinned to the pre-rotation key, so every signature made with the current signer fails. Requesting security review before we update the pinned trust entry. For reference, the key the bundle was actually signed with is below.

deploy key for tahof-yadup: bky6_JWeaJq

## Runbook: Keyturner rotation before release

Heads-up for release managers: run the Keyturner secrets-rotation utility at least 24 hours before cutting a release, not during the freeze window. Rotation staggers credentials across services, so a mid-freeze run can leave half the fleet on old tokens if anything stalls. If a rotation does hang, the resume command is safe to re-run — it's idempotent. Full command reference, timing guidance, and the rollback steps are on the internal page below.

wiki page, bagaf-fawip: https://harbor.tolvaqsys.local/pages/repo/pages/secrets/eac969ffc71f356b

- [ ] Step 7: Archive cold storage buckets (Glacierline tier). Confirm both ceremony witnesses are present, verify bucket manifests match the Oxbow ledger, then seal the archive key shares. Plugin authors may observe but not handle shares. Once sealed, the archive index itself is encrypted and can only be reopened with the passphrase below.

vault phrase of badup-hahig = tamael-aldael-kelmir-istael-fenok-istwyn-tamius-jorath-oliion